taybert · 08/12/2016 07:08

Gap sizing is weird. I'm a pretty standard size 10. I've got other Gap jeans which are a 27 but it said the model was wearing 27 and she looked a lot thinner than me so I got a 28. They seemed fine when I tried them on but having worn them all day I think I should've gone for a 27 as the waist has loosened slightly. That said I didn't need to keep hoiking them up, I just think the smaller size would've been a better fit.

Finally got the correct size of Wonderfit jeans from Asda! Well, I say correct size - they come in 10-12 and 14-16, whereas I'd really like a 12-14, but decided to size up rather than down Grin.

They are good on the gaping at the back front - as they're high waisted they are pretty snug as they have loads of stretch in them. Definite thumbs up in this front.

In the downside, they are so stretchy that they're not like proper jeans in my opinion, definitely more jeggings. Also I'm 5'9" and could do with them being an inch longer, but they're not unwearable. So they're not going to replace my favourite jeans. But for a cheap casual option, I think they're pretty good!
